WebCapillary sample A capillary sample is a blood sample collected by pricking the skin. Capillaries are tiny blood vessels near the surface of the skin. How the Test is Performed The test is done in the following way: The area is cleansed with antiseptic. The skin of the finger, heel, or another area is pricked with a sharp needle or a lancet. WebAug 19, 2024 · A capillary is an extremely small blood vessel located within the tissues of the body that transports blood from arteries to veins.Capillaries are most abundant in tissues and organs that are metabolically active. For example, muscle tissues and the kidneys have a greater amount of capillary networks than do connective tissues. WebCapillaries also support a variety of organs and systems. They support the: Bone marrow, by enabling new blood cells to enter your bloodstream. Brain, by forming the blood-brain barrier. This structure delivers nutrients to the brain while preventing toxins from passing through. Endocrine system, by delivering hormones to specific organs.
